> Il giorno 21/mag/2015, alle ore 11:07, Gabriele Battaglia <iz4...@libero.it> > ha scritto: > > > > Carlos Catucci, alle 11:03 del 21/05/2015, digitò: >> >> 2015-05-21 11:01 GMT+02:00 Gabriele Battaglia <iz4...@libero.it >> <mailto:iz4...@libero.it>>: >> >> import gettext >> help(gettext) >> >> >> Perdonami Gabriele, non riesco a capire se il problema sia nel fatto che >> non hai cpaito a cosa serva l'istruzione help oppure se sia quanto >> tornato dalla stessa. > Ciao Carlos e perdonami tu, sono stato poco chiaro. > Ho letto l'help perchè sto cercando di rendere localizzabile una specie di > giochino che ho scritto in Python e che vorrei far provare ad amici che non > parlano italiano. > Le alternative sono 2: modifico tutte le prints dello script e gli mando la > copia modificata, oppure, imparo ad usare questa gettext che mi pare consenta > di trasferire in un file sorgente della lingua, tutti i messaggi che > compaiono nello script. > Così facendo puoi continuare a sviluppare una sola versione, aggiornando e > traducendo i messaggi in un file esterno, quando serve. > > Chiedevo alla lista un esempio di come funziona questa classe gettext, così > per avere uno spunto di partenza. > Mi chiedevo, come si scriverebbe il classico helloworld.py, usando gettext? > Grazie per l’interesse.
http://inventwithpython.com/blog/2014/12/20/translate-your-python-3-program-with-the-gettext-module/ prova a vedere se ti è di aiuto… G _______________________________________________ Python mailing list Python@lists.python.it http://lists.python.it/mailman/listinfo/python